메뉴 건너뛰기




Volumn 15, Issue 2, 2007, Pages 199-221

Reducing the number of fitness evaluations in graph genetic programming using a canonical graph indexed database

Author keywords

Fitness database; Genetic programming; Graph isomorphism; Graph representation; Neutrality

Indexed keywords

ALGORITHM; ARTICLE; BIOLOGICAL MODEL; COMPUTER GRAPHICS; COMPUTER PROGRAM; EVOLUTION; GENETIC DATABASE; PHENOTYPE;

EID: 34447508234     PISSN: 10636560     EISSN: 15309304     Source Type: Journal    
DOI: 10.1162/evco.2007.15.2.199     Document Type: Article
Times cited : (13)

References (56)
  • 2
    • 24644519555 scopus 로고    scopus 로고
    • The lawnmower problem revisited: Stack-based genetic programming and automatically defined functions
    • J. R. Koza Ed, Morgan Kaufmann
    • Bruce, W. S. (1997). The lawnmower problem revisited: Stack-based genetic programming and automatically defined functions. In J. R. Koza (Ed.), Genetic Programming 1997: Proceedings of the Second Annual Conference, pp. 52-57. Morgan Kaufmann.
    • (1997) Genetic Programming 1997: Proceedings of the Second Annual Conference , pp. 52-57
    • Bruce, W.S.1
  • 3
    • 84947942216 scopus 로고    scopus 로고
    • Alogtime algorithms for tree isomorphism, comparison, and canonization
    • Computational Logic and Proof Theory, 5th Kurt Gödel Colloquium '97, of, Springer-Verlag
    • Buss, S. (1997). Alogtime algorithms for tree isomorphism, comparison, and canonization. In Computational Logic and Proof Theory, 5th Kurt Gödel Colloquium '97, Volume 1289 of LNCS, pp. 18-33. Springer-Verlag.
    • (1997) LNCS , vol.1289 , pp. 18-33
    • Buss, S.1
  • 4
    • 0011319929 scopus 로고    scopus 로고
    • Evolutionary programming with tree mutations: Evolving computer programs without crossover
    • J. R. Koza Ed, Morgan Kaufmann
    • Chellapilla, K. (1997). Evolutionary programming with tree mutations: Evolving computer programs without crossover. In J. R. Koza (Ed.), Genetic Programming 1997: Proceedings of the Second Annual Conference, pp. 431-438. Morgan Kaufmann.
    • (1997) Genetic Programming 1997: Proceedings of the Second Annual Conference , pp. 431-438
    • Chellapilla, K.1
  • 5
    • 0042496103 scopus 로고    scopus 로고
    • Learning equivalence classes of Bayesian-network structures
    • Chickering, D. M. (2002). Learning equivalence classes of Bayesian-network structures. Journal of Machine Learning Research 2, 445-498.
    • (2002) Journal of Machine Learning Research , vol.2 , pp. 445-498
    • Chickering, D.M.1
  • 6
    • 84939651896 scopus 로고    scopus 로고
    • An analysis of Kozas computational effort statistic for genetic programming
    • J. A. Foster, E. Lutton, J. Miller, C. Ryan, and A. G. B. Tettamanzi (Eds, Genetic Programming: 5th European Conference EuroGP 2002, of, Springer-Verlag
    • Christensen, S. and F. Oppacher (2002). An analysis of Kozas computational effort statistic for genetic programming. In J. A. Foster, E. Lutton, J. Miller, C. Ryan, and A. G. B. Tettamanzi (Eds.), Genetic Programming: 5th European Conference (EuroGP 2002), Volume 2278 of LNCS, pp. 182-191. Springer-Verlag.
    • (2002) LNCS , vol.2278 , pp. 182-191
    • Christensen, S.1    Oppacher, F.2
  • 7
    • 0025316459 scopus 로고
    • The geometry of evolution
    • Conrad, M. (1990). The geometry of evolution. Biosystems 24, 61-81.
    • (1990) Biosystems , vol.24 , pp. 61-81
    • Conrad, M.1
  • 8
    • 0002258659 scopus 로고
    • A representation for the adaptive generation of simple sequential programs
    • J. J. Grefenstette Ed, Lawrence Erlbaum Associates
    • Cramer, N. L. (1985). A representation for the adaptive generation of simple sequential programs. In J. J. Grefenstette (Ed.), Proceedings of an International Conference on Genetic Algorithms and their Application, pp. 183-187. Lawrence Erlbaum Associates.
    • (1985) Proceedings of an International Conference on Genetic Algorithms and their Application , pp. 183-187
    • Cramer, N.L.1
  • 9
    • 0042164758 scopus 로고
    • Effects of locality in individual and population evolution
    • K. E. Kinnear jr, Ed, MIT Press
    • D'haeseleer, P. and J. Bluming (1994). Effects of locality in individual and population evolution. In K. E. Kinnear jr. (Ed.), Advances in Genetic Programming. MIT Press.
    • (1994) Advances in Genetic Programming
    • D'haeseleer, P.1    Bluming, J.2
  • 10
    • 84901397864 scopus 로고    scopus 로고
    • On the search space of genetic programming and its relation to nature's search space
    • IEEE Press
    • Ebner, M. (1999). On the search space of genetic programming and its relation to nature's search space. In In IEEE Congress on Evolutionary Computation 1999 (CEC 1999), pp. 1357-1361. IEEE Press.
    • (1999) In IEEE Congress on Evolutionary Computation 1999 (CEC , pp. 1357-1361
    • Ebner, M.1
  • 11
    • 85040437712 scopus 로고    scopus 로고
    • How neutral networks influence evolvability
    • Ebner, M., M. Shackleton, and R. Shipman (2001). How neutral networks influence evolvability. Complexity 7(2), 19-33.
    • (2001) Complexity , vol.7 , Issue.2 , pp. 19-33
    • Ebner, M.1    Shackleton, M.2    Shipman, R.3
  • 15
    • 84977058391 scopus 로고
    • Automatic definition of modular neural networks
    • Gruau, F. (1995). Automatic definition of modular neural networks. Adaptive Behavior 3(2), 151-183.
    • (1995) Adaptive Behavior , vol.3 , Issue.2 , pp. 151-183
    • Gruau, F.1
  • 17
    • 0016117886 scopus 로고
    • Efficient planarity testing
    • Hopcroft, J. and R. Tarjan (1974). Efficient planarity testing. Journal of the ACM 21(4), 549-568.
    • (1974) Journal of the ACM , vol.21 , Issue.4 , pp. 549-568
    • Hopcroft, J.1    Tarjan, R.2
  • 18
    • 0029791455 scopus 로고    scopus 로고
    • Exploring phenotype space through neutral evolution
    • Huynen, M. A. (1996). Exploring phenotype space through neutral evolution. Journal of Molecular Evolution 43, 165-169.
    • (1996) Journal of Molecular Evolution , vol.43 , pp. 165-169
    • Huynen, M.A.1
  • 19
    • 0036464942 scopus 로고    scopus 로고
    • Effects of phenotypic redundancy in structure optimization
    • Igel, C. and P. Stagge (2002a). Effects of phenotypic redundancy in structure optimization. IEEE Transactions on Evolutionary Computation 6(1), 74-85.
    • (2002) IEEE Transactions on Evolutionary Computation , vol.6 , Issue.1 , pp. 74-85
    • Igel, C.1    Stagge, P.2
  • 21
    • 4344702275 scopus 로고    scopus 로고
    • Neutrality and self-adaptation
    • Igel, C. and M. Toussaint (2003). Neutrality and self-adaptation. Natural Computing 2(2), 117-13.
    • (2003) Natural Computing , vol.2 , Issue.2 , pp. 117-113
    • Igel, C.1    Toussaint, M.2
  • 22
    • 84943257091 scopus 로고    scopus 로고
    • Lineargraph GP - a new GP structure
    • E. Lutton, J. Foster, J. Miller, C. Ryan, and A. Tettamanzi Eds, Genetic Programming, Proceedings of 5th EuroGP, of, Springer
    • Kantschik, W. and W Banzhaf (2002). Lineargraph GP - a new GP structure. In E. Lutton, J. Foster, J. Miller, C. Ryan, and A. Tettamanzi (Eds.), Genetic Programming, Proceedings of 5th EuroGP, Volume 2278 of LNCS, pp. 83-92. Springer.
    • (2002) LNCS , vol.2278 , pp. 83-92
    • Kantschik, W.1    Banzhaf, W.2
  • 23
    • 0014421064 scopus 로고
    • Evolutionary rate at the molecular level
    • Kimura, M. (1968). Evolutionary rate at the molecular level. Nature 217, 624-626.
    • (1968) Nature , vol.217 , pp. 624-626
    • Kimura, M.1
  • 24
    • 33746086721 scopus 로고    scopus 로고
    • On graph isomorphism for restricted graph classes
    • A. Beckmann, U. Berger, B. Löwe, and J. V. Tucker Eds, Logical Approaches to Computational Barriers, Second Conference on Computability in Europe, CiE 2006, of, Springer-Verlag
    • Köbler, J. (2006). On graph isomorphism for restricted graph classes. In A. Beckmann, U. Berger, B. Löwe, and J. V. Tucker (Eds.), Logical Approaches to Computational Barriers, Second Conference on Computability in Europe, CiE 2006, Volume 3988 of LNCS, pp. 241-256. Springer-Verlag.
    • (2006) LNCS , vol.3988 , pp. 241-256
    • Köbler, J.1
  • 28
    • 34547506857 scopus 로고    scopus 로고
    • Artificial ant problem revisited
    • V. W. Porto Ed, Seventh Annual Conference on Evolutionary Programming, of, Springer-Verlag
    • Kuscu, I. (1998). Artificial ant problem revisited. In V. W. Porto (Ed.), Seventh Annual Conference on Evolutionary Programming, Volume 1447 of LNCS, pp. 799-808. Springer-Verlag.
    • (1998) LNCS , vol.1447 , pp. 799-808
    • Kuscu, I.1
  • 32
    • 3543099086 scopus 로고    scopus 로고
    • Is the perfect the enemy of the good?
    • W. B. Langdon, E. Cantú-Paz, K. Mathias, R. Roy, D. Davis, R. Poli, K. Balakrishnan, V. Honavar, G. Rudolph, J. Wegener, L. Bull, M. A. Potter, A. C. Schultz, J. F. Miller, E. Burke, and N. Jonoska Eds, Morgan Kaufmann
    • Luke, S. and L. Panait (2002). Is the perfect the enemy of the good? In W. B. Langdon, E. Cantú-Paz, K. Mathias, R. Roy, D. Davis, R. Poli, K. Balakrishnan, V. Honavar, G. Rudolph, J. Wegener, L. Bull, M. A. Potter, A. C. Schultz, J. F. Miller, E. Burke, and N. Jonoska (Eds.), Proceedings of the Genetic and Evolutionary Computation Conference, GECCO 2002, pp. 820-828. Morgan Kaufmann.
    • (2002) Proceedings of the Genetic and Evolutionary Computation Conference, GECCO 2002 , pp. 820-828
    • Luke, S.1    Panait, L.2
  • 33
    • 0031557885 scopus 로고    scopus 로고
    • What exactly are genomes, genotypes and phenotypes? And what about phenomes?
    • Mahner, M. and M. Kary (1997). What exactly are genomes, genotypes and phenotypes? And what about phenomes? Journal of Theoretical Biology 186(1), 55-63.
    • (1997) Journal of Theoretical Biology , vol.186 , Issue.1 , pp. 55-63
    • Mahner, M.1    Kary, M.2
  • 34
    • 0002603293 scopus 로고
    • Practical graph isomorphism
    • McKay, B. D. (1981). Practical graph isomorphism. Congressus Numerantium 30, 47-87.
    • (1981) Congressus Numerantium , vol.30 , pp. 47-87
    • McKay, B.D.1
  • 35
    • 34547527489 scopus 로고    scopus 로고
    • McKay, B. D. (1990). nauty user's guide (version 1.5). Technical Report TR-CS-90-02, Australian National University, Computer Science Department, Canberra, Australia.
    • McKay, B. D. (1990). nauty user's guide (version 1.5). Technical Report TR-CS-90-02, Australian National University, Computer Science Department, Canberra, Australia.
  • 37
    • 34547509821 scopus 로고    scopus 로고
    • Graphbasierte Genetische Programmierung. Dissertation, Chair of System Analysis, Computer Science Department, Dortmund University, Dortmund,Germany
    • Niehaus, J. (2003). Graphbasierte Genetische Programmierung. Dissertation, Chair of System Analysis, Computer Science Department, Dortmund University, Dortmund,Germany. http://de.scientificcommons.org/866201.
    • (2003)
    • Niehaus, J.1
  • 38
    • 84937399589 scopus 로고    scopus 로고
    • Adaption of operator probabilities in genetic programming
    • J. Miller, M. Tomassini, P. L. Lanzi, C. Ryan, A. G. B. Tettamanzi, and W. B. Langdon (Eds, Genetic Programming: 4th European Conference EuroGP 2001, of, Spring-Verlag
    • Niehaus, J. and W. Banzhaf (2001). Adaption of operator probabilities in genetic programming. In J. Miller, M. Tomassini, P. L. Lanzi, C. Ryan, A. G. B. Tettamanzi, and W. B. Langdon (Eds.), Genetic Programming: 4th European Conference (EuroGP 2001), Volume 2038 of LNCS, pp. 325-336. Spring-Verlag.
    • (2001) LNCS , vol.2038 , pp. 325-336
    • Niehaus, J.1    Banzhaf, W.2
  • 39
    • 34547539362 scopus 로고    scopus 로고
    • More on computational effort statistic for genetic programming
    • C. Ryan, T. Soule, M. Keijzer, E. P. K. Tsang, R. Poli, and E. Costa (Eds, Genetic Programming: 6th European Conference EuroGP 2003, of, Springer-Verlag
    • Niehaus, J. and W. Banzhaf (2003). More on computational effort statistic for genetic programming. In C. Ryan, T. Soule, M. Keijzer, E. P. K. Tsang, R. Poli, and E. Costa (Eds.), Genetic Programming: 6th European Conference (EuroGP 2003), Volume 2610 of LNCS, pp. 164-172. Springer-Verlag.
    • (2003) LNCS , vol.2610 , pp. 164-172
    • Niehaus, J.1    Banzhaf, W.2
  • 41
    • 0242412778 scopus 로고    scopus 로고
    • Evolution of graph-like programs with parallel distributed genetic programming
    • T. Bäck Ed, Morgan Kaufmann
    • Poli, R. (1997). Evolution of graph-like programs with parallel distributed genetic programming. In T. Bäck (Ed.), Genetic Algorithms: Proceedings of the Seventh International Conference, pp. 345-353. Morgan Kaufmann.
    • (1997) Genetic Algorithms: Proceedings of the Seventh International Conference , pp. 345-353
    • Poli, R.1
  • 42
    • 4344569990 scopus 로고    scopus 로고
    • Landscapes and molecular evolution
    • Schuster, P. (1996). Landscapes and molecular evolution. Physica D 107, 331-363.
    • (1996) Physica D , vol.107 , pp. 331-363
    • Schuster, P.1
  • 43
    • 0003240667 scopus 로고    scopus 로고
    • Molecular insights into evolution of phenotypes
    • J. P. Crutchfield and P. Schuster Eds, Evolutionary Dynamics, Exploring the Interplay of Accident, Selection, Neutrality and Function, Oxford University Press
    • Schuster, P. (2002). Molecular insights into evolution of phenotypes. In J. P. Crutchfield and P. Schuster (Eds.), Evolutionary Dynamics - Exploring the Interplay of Accident, Selection, Neutrality and Function, Santa Fe Institute Series in the Science of Complexity. Oxford University Press.
    • (2002) Santa Fe Institute Series in the Science of Complexity
    • Schuster, P.1
  • 44
    • 34547548835 scopus 로고    scopus 로고
    • Spector, L. and S. Luke (1996). Cultural transmission of information in gp. In J. R. K. et.al (Ed.), Genetic Programming 1996: Proceedings of the First Annual Conference, pp. 209-214. MIT Press.
    • Spector, L. and S. Luke (1996). Cultural transmission of information in gp. In J. R. K. et.al (Ed.), Genetic Programming 1996: Proceedings of the First Annual Conference, pp. 209-214. MIT Press.
  • 46
    • 0002014916 scopus 로고    scopus 로고
    • Structure optimization and isomorphisms
    • L. Kallel, B. Naudts, and A. Rogers Eds, Theoretical Aspects of Evolutionary Computing, Springer-Verlag
    • Stagge, P. and C. Igel (2001). Structure optimization and isomorphisms. In L. Kallel, B. Naudts, and A. Rogers (Eds.), Theoretical Aspects of Evolutionary Computing, Natural Computing series, pp. 409-422. Springer-Verlag.
    • (2001) Natural Computing series , pp. 409-422
    • Stagge, P.1    Igel, C.2
  • 47
    • 0001842954 scopus 로고
    • A study of reproduction in generational and steady state genetic algorithms
    • G. J. E. Rawlins Ed, Morgan Kaufmann Publishers
    • Syswerda, G. (1991). A study of reproduction in generational and steady state genetic algorithms. In G. J. E. Rawlins (Ed.), Foundations of Genetic Algorithms (FOGA I), pp. 94-101. Morgan Kaufmann Publishers.
    • (1991) Foundations of Genetic Algorithms (FOGA I) , pp. 94-101
    • Syswerda, G.1
  • 51
    • 4344680895 scopus 로고    scopus 로고
    • On the evolution of phenotypic exploration distributions
    • C. Cotta, K. De Jong, R. Poli, and J. Rowe Eds, Morgan Kaufmann
    • Toussaint, M. (2003). On the evolution of phenotypic exploration distributions. In C. Cotta, K. De Jong, R. Poli, and J. Rowe (Eds.), Foundations of Genetic Algorithms 7 (FOGA VII), pp. 169-182. Morgan Kaufmann.
    • (2003) Foundations of Genetic Algorithms 7 (FOGA VII) , pp. 169-182
    • Toussaint, M.1
  • 53
    • 0002988210 scopus 로고
    • Computing machinery and intelligence
    • Turing, A. M. (1950). Computing machinery and intelligence. Mind 59, 433-46.
    • (1950) Mind , vol.59 , pp. 433-446
    • Turing, A.M.1
  • 55
    • 0003389370 scopus 로고
    • The GENITOR algorithm and selection pressure: Why rank-based allocation of reproductive trials is best
    • J. D. Schaffer Ed, George Mason University: Morgan Kaufmann
    • Whitley, L. D. (1989). The GENITOR algorithm and selection pressure: Why rank-based allocation of reproductive trials is best. In J. D. Schaffer (Ed.), Proceedings of the Third International Conference on Genetic Algorithms (ICGA'89), Jul 4-7, pp. 116-121. George Mason University: Morgan Kaufmann.
    • (1989) Proceedings of the Third International Conference on Genetic Algorithms (ICGA'89), Jul 4-7 , pp. 116-121
    • Whitley, L.D.1
  • 56
    • 0034895529 scopus 로고    scopus 로고
    • Adaptive evolution on neutral networks
    • Wilke, C. O. (2001). Adaptive evolution on neutral networks. Bulletin of Mathematical Biology 63(4), 715-730.
    • (2001) Bulletin of Mathematical Biology , vol.63 , Issue.4 , pp. 715-730
    • Wilke, C.O.1


* 이 정보는 Elsevier사의 SCOPUS DB에서 KISTI가 분석하여 추출한 것입니다.